What is the importance of food chains and food webs?

Short Answer

Food chains and food webs show how food and energy move from one living organism to another in an ecosystem. They explain who eats whom and how living organisms are connected for survival.

Food chains and food webs are important because they maintain balance in nature. They help control population size, support energy flow, and ensure proper use of natural resources. Without them, ecosystems would become unstable.

Importance of Food Chains and Food Webs

Food chains and food webs are essential concepts in biology that explain feeding relationships among living organisms in an ecosystem. All living beings need food for energy, growth, and survival. Food chains and food webs help us understand how this food energy is transferred from one organism to another and how life is interconnected in nature.

Understanding Energy Flow in Ecosystems

The main importance of food chains and food webs is that they explain the flow of energy in an ecosystem. Energy enters the ecosystem through sunlight, which is captured by green plants during photosynthesis. These plants are called producers.

Herbivores eat plants and obtain energy stored in plant food. Carnivores eat herbivores and gain energy from them. Omnivores eat both plants and animals. At each step, energy is transferred from one level to another. Food chains and food webs clearly show this movement of energy.

Role in Maintaining Ecological Balance

Food chains and food webs help maintain ecological balance. They regulate the population size of organisms in an ecosystem. For example, if herbivores increase too much, plants may decrease. Carnivores help control herbivore populations and prevent overgrazing.

If one level of a food chain is disturbed, it affects all other levels. Food webs show multiple feeding relationships, which provide stability to ecosystems. If one food source becomes scarce, organisms can survive by using alternative food sources.

Control of Population Size

Food chains and food webs play a key role in controlling population growth. Predators keep prey populations under control, preventing overcrowding and resource depletion.

For example, if predators disappear, prey populations may increase rapidly, leading to shortage of food and environmental damage. Food chains help keep populations balanced and ecosystems healthy.

Importance for Biodiversity

Food webs support biodiversity by allowing many species to coexist in the same ecosystem. A food web includes many interconnected food chains, which means organisms have more than one feeding option.

This diversity of feeding relationships increases ecosystem stability and reduces the risk of extinction. Food webs protect ecosystems from sudden changes by spreading energy flow across many organisms.

Recycling of Nutrients

Food chains and food webs help in the recycling of nutrients. When plants and animals die, decomposers such as bacteria and fungi break them down into simple substances.

These nutrients return to the soil and are reused by plants. This recycling process is essential for continuous food production and soil fertility. Food webs include decomposers, showing their importance in ecosystems.

Understanding Human Impact on Ecosystems

Food chains and food webs help us understand the impact of human activities on ecosystems. Pollution, deforestation, hunting, and overfishing can disturb food chains.

For example, use of pesticides can kill insects that are food for birds, leading to a decline in bird populations. By studying food chains and food webs, humans can take steps to reduce environmental damage and protect ecosystems.

Importance in Agriculture and Fisheries

Food chains are important in agriculture and fisheries. Understanding feeding relationships helps farmers control pests naturally using biological control methods.

In fisheries, knowledge of food webs helps maintain fish populations and prevent overfishing. Protecting lower levels of food chains ensures survival of higher-level organisms.

Role in Environmental Conservation

Food chains and food webs help conservationists protect ecosystems. They identify key species that play important roles in energy transfer.

Protecting these species helps maintain ecosystem stability. Conservation plans are often based on understanding food webs and feeding relationships.

Educational and Scientific Importance

Food chains and food webs are important tools in biology education. They help students understand complex ecological relationships in a simple way.

Scientists use food web studies to monitor ecosystem health and predict environmental changes. This helps in planning conservation and restoration programs.

Conclusion

Food chains and food webs are important because they explain how energy and nutrients move through ecosystems. They help maintain ecological balance, control populations, support biodiversity, and recycle nutrients. By understanding food chains and food webs, humans can protect ecosystems and ensure the survival of life on Earth.
